John Courtney Murray and the Dilemma of Religious Toleration. By Keith J. Pavlischek. Thomas Jefferson University Press. 290 pages. $22.50.
Keith Pavlischek's valuable book advances the Murray discussion right where Murray's writings most repay careful reading: religious liberty. Pavlischek, an evangelical Protestant, analyzes Murray's published and unpublished writings on religious liberty, and examines his role in the drafting and revision of Vatican II's Dignitatis Humanae. Pavlischek notes that Murray was not entirely pleased with DH. But Pavlischek's is the best discussion of just how the moral-theological defense of religious freedom advanced by the French prevailed over Murray's view that a doctrine of limited, constitutional government be the "juridical" centerpiece of the argument.
